logo

Output 5d391142d4871c5da1b637844f68e2b9611bec081b2d906ebe3e4b9e4d8eff76:3

value
453869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66103990d6fc930bff6341730b453d495405c78 OP_EQUAL
address
3Nh9ZKUjCvRf8gWo4DMkx9h5fRr5JrrChz
transaction
5d391142d4871c5da1b637844f68e2b9611bec081b2d906ebe3e4b9e4d8eff76